clutch or the tranny problem?

I have an Evo MR and i need help whether its something to do with my clutch or if my transmission is about to just blow any moment. I only had this car for 6 months and seems like this car gives me a lot of problems and i don't abuse the hell out of this car. But last night i raced my friend and later today while i was driving, i can hear a chattering noise. It sounds like the throw out bearing to me but i'm not quite sure with that and want to know if anyone had the same problem with the MR. When i press on the clutch pedal it's not smooth and it feels like a small vibration. everytime i let go of the clutch, the chattering noise becomes really loud and when i press on it, the noise dies out. when i shift it to 2nd and 3rd gear, sometimes it grinds and sometimes it don't at all. if it is the tranny issue, i think i'm going to just go for a 5 speed conversion and does anyone know the estimate price of getting it done? it seems like your clutch isnt disengaging all the way. do you have an aftermarket clutch? usually if you have an aftermarket clutch like a ACT stage (whatever) you get alot of chatter.
